Great question. Since no one chose to answer, I'll report what Motor Trend said:
0 to 60: SRT-10 3.9, GTS 4.0
1/4 mile: SRT-10 11.8 @ 123.6, GTS 12.2 @ 119
60 to 0: SRT-10 97 ft, GTS 129 ft
